American Airlines has faced criticism regarding its buy on board food selection for economy class passengers. Currently, the airline's offerings are limited to flights over 1,300 miles, featuring only packaged nuts, chips, and a fruit and cheese plate. Pre-ordering is not available, which has disappointed many travelers. Before the pandemic, American Airlines provided a wider selection of options on flights over 700 miles, but the current limited offerings have led to the airline ranking lowest among major US carriers in terms of buy on board food options. In contrast, Alaska Airlines has been praised for its extensive menu, followed by United and Delta. This shift in strategy may be influenced by the number of complimentary items provided to AAdvantage Executive Platinum members. The pandemic has had a significant negative impact on food offerings across the airline industry, including American Airlines. [166514d9]

In a recent review, American Airlines received a positive response for its economy class on a flight from Dallas/Fort Worth to New York. The flight was comfortable and on time, with the Boeing 737-800 featuring tablet holders instead of seatback screens, which the author preferred. The author noted that the TSA PreCheck lines were getting longer. The plane had 172 seats in 3x3 rows, including 16 first-class recliners, 24 main-cabin-extra seats, and 132 standard economy seats. The legroom in regular coach was 30 inches. American offers inflight entertainment streamed to personal devices with tablet holders, which the author found preferable for a better viewing angle. The inflight entertainment options were comparable to those of Delta, United, and Southwest. The T-Mobile WiFi on the flight was fast and allowed streaming. American's reliability and customer service have reportedly improved since 2021, with proactive gate agents checking carry-ons as the flight was full. The airline is also working on enhancing disruption transparency and communication with passengers. [3053ebf6]

Alaska Airlines will introduce hot food options for all passengers, including those in economy class, for the first time since 2017. Starting on May 22, 2024, passengers on most flights over 1,100 miles will have the option to choose from up to five chef-curated dishes, including at least one hot meal. These meals can only be pre-ordered and cannot be purchased on board. The new menu items, resulting from an overhaul of the airline's onboard galley kitchens, will include options like a carnitas breakfast bowl and spicy Panang chicken curry. Prices for these meals will range from $10.50 to $11.50. [8845bb6c]

Sophie Foster, Deputy Travel Editor for Mailonline, has expressed her fondness for plane food, describing it as 'nectar'. She acknowledges that while plane food is often criticized for being unhealthy, it provides a welcome distraction during long flights. Foster explains that the taste of food is dulled at high altitudes, leading to meals being packed with added salt and sugar to enhance flavor. Despite the negative perceptions, she remains a fan of in-flight meals. [eecda640]

A British Airways flight attendant has provided tips to prevent bloating during flights, a common issue due to reduced air pressure and dehydration. Recommendations include hydrating before and after the flight and avoiding heavy, spicy, and greasy foods. Instead, she suggests drinking peppermint tea to alleviate discomfort. [dd2078b5]
